Output 1677eaa43a3da045682768b9c222ff14f155f1cb3d99ffc6277b7dd1aa5cbfb4:2

value
131528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c21b0582868af93c9e4043207a36de75cbed117a OP_EQUALVERIFY OP_CHECKSIG
address
1JhLThoLEAqm4byrSYMEvnYwWRoQbab5kM
transaction
1677eaa43a3da045682768b9c222ff14f155f1cb3d99ffc6277b7dd1aa5cbfb4
spent
true